The novel The Register describes from varying perspectives the lives of two Austrian brothers. Moritz and Vinzenz, who meet again after a long estrangement. They remember shared and individual experiences, prompted by questions from their sister, photographs in family albums, and encounters with current reality during a visit to their home town. The memories that form most of the novel's substance highlight the fundamental problems of their development and the reasons for their successes and failures in life: sibling rivalries, conflicts between them and their father; inability and unwillingness to identify with their Austrian heritage; missed opportunities, breakdowns in communication, failed relationships with other people; guilt incurred through betrayal of their girlfriend Magda and each other.
